3D ACTIVE SURFACE

Strauder presents a pioneering 3D Active Surface technology. This involves using layered micropores to actively absorb the surrounding bone tissue into the implant surface, resulting in an enhanced osseointegration process. The surface is created through an advanced process of anodisation, which is commonly used in astronautics. This might sound like rocket science, yet the benefits are completely practical – a reduction in treatment times for dentists and a faster healing time and more secure result for patients.

THE BEAUTY OF OUR
PRODUCTION PROCESS

Our production principles are as simple as they can be: we choose the best method at every stage of the process. Our high quality standards are evident throughout, starting with our selection of titanium for our dental implants. Titanium is known for its excellent compatibility with the human body. Our production lines are equipped with the most prominent Swiss machinery and operated by carefully trained technicians. The signature 3D Active Surface is created through a series of precisely pointed electric shocks, thickening the oxide layers in the metal.
